Another small but essential detail, the colors you use on your resume can have a big impact on your job application. If you’re applying to a job in a traditional industry, like law, accounting, or real estate, consider using no color on your resume, or use a professional resume color like dark blue or green.

Blue has a number of connotations that are useful in a professional setting, such as honesty, trust, and responsibility. Plus, it can help to grab the reader’s attention and break up content without being too distracting.
